📅  最后修改于: 2023-12-03 15:32:27.313000             🧑  作者: Mango
Kafka 是一个高性能的分布式消息系统,可用于构建实时数据管道和流处理应用程序。Kafka Consumer 可以用来读取一些传递到 Kafka Topic 上的消息,这种消极操作通常用于测试或者调试。在本文中,我们将介绍如何使用 Kafka 控制台消费者读取 Kafka Topic。
在继续之前,请确保已经正确安装并配置了 Kafka。如果没有,请参阅 Kafka 官方文档进行安装和配置。
使用以下命令启动 Kafka Consumer,其中bootstrap-server
是 Kafka 的地址,topic-name
是要消费的 Topic 名称。如果你熟悉 Kafka 的配置文件,你也可以使用配置文件启动 Consumer。
bin/kafka-console-consumer.sh --bootstrap-server localhost:9092 --topic topic-name
一旦 Kafka Consumer 运行起来,它将开始读取 Kafka Topic 上的消息。你可以看到类似于以下屏幕输出:
key1: value1
key2: value2
key3: value3
当你想停止消费时,可以使用 CTRL-C
命令退出 Kafka Consumer。
在本文中,我们介绍了如何使用 Kafka 控制台消费者读取 Kafka Topic。在实践中,你可以使用 Kafka Consumer API 来消费 Topic,也可以使用你喜欢的编程语言。Kafka 消费者是必不可少的工具,可以用来测试生产者,调试您的应用程序或查看 Kafka 上的消息。